FYI, blockchain.com in general isn't a custodial wallet.
Their "
Buy Bitcoin" service however is custodial because it's tied with their exchange, just like other Buy crypto services and exchanges.

I'm not taking sides but this contradicts the first statement and those problems are from newbies who think that blockchain.com is a custodial wallet.
There are a couple of info within the wallet about not-to-be-able to recover those info since those aren't stored in their server.
Since it's a non-custodial wallet, all those sensitive data is in their own (
user's) care,
just like Electrum, no one can directly help you if you lost your seed phrase or forgot the wallet password.
The issue that can be blamed to them are problems with logging in, not receiving 2fa/email authentication, wrong balance, etc."
Account freeze" can only be done to the trading wallet and only when you bought bitcoins using cards and other matters.
